Cursor
Intelligenter Code-Editor, automatisch Code generieren und umgestalten
Einführung
Was ist Cursor?
Cursor stellt eine moderne, KI-angereicherte Entwicklungsumgebung dar, die Programmierer durch die Integration künstlicher Intelligenz in ihren Arbeitsprozess produktiver macht. Als Ableger von Visual Studio Code bewahrt es die vollständige Unterstützung für VS Code-Erweiterungen und Konfigurationen, während es erweiterte KI-Fähigkeiten wie Codegenerierung durch natürliche Sprache, intelligente Mehrzeilen-Restrukturierung und Live-Abfragen der Codebasis einführt. Diese Plattform befähigt Entwickler, Code schneller zu verfassen, zu modifizieren, Fehler zu beheben und Strukturen zu optimieren – unterstützt durch vorausschauende Vervollständigung, Chat-gestützte Programmierhilfe und KI-gestützte Kooperationswerkzeuge. Perfekt geeignet für Entwicklungsteams und individuelle Programmierer, die ihre Softwareentwicklungsprozesse optimieren wollen.
Hauptfunktionen
• KI-gestützte Codeerstellung: Erstellen oder modernisieren Sie komplette Klassen und Methoden mittels einfacher Sprachbefehle und vereinfachen Sie so anspruchsvolle Programmieraufgaben.
• Intelligente Vervollständigung und Restrukturierung: Antizipiert bevorstehende Änderungen und empfiehlt mehrzeilige Code-Optimierungen für beschleunigte Entwicklung und effektives Refactoring.
• Kontextuelles Codebase-Verständnis: Stellen Sie sprachbasierte Fragen zu Ihrer gesamten Codebasis und erhalten Sie umgehend passende Antworten, Verweise und Dokumentationshinweise.
• VS Code-Erweiterungskompatibilität: Funktioniert mit allen VS Code-Erweiterungen, Design-Themes und Tastaturkurzbefehlen für eine bekannte und individualisierbare Arbeitsumgebung.
• Integrierte KI-Chat-Schnittstelle: Kommunizieren Sie mit Ihrer Codebasis über Chat-Modi, um Anfragen zu stellen, Code anzupassen und KI-Agenten für Aufgabenaustomatisierung einzusetzen.
• Kollaborations- und Effizienzwerkzeuge: Integrierter Chat-Verlauf, Team-Kooperationsfunktionen und Tastenkombinationen erhöhen die Produktivität für Entwickler und Teams.
Anwendungsfälle
• Beschleunigte Softwareentwicklung: Programmierer können durch KI-Unterstützung Code erzeugen und umstrukturieren, was manuelle Arbeitslast verringert.
• Codebase-Erkundung und Fehlerdiagnose: Nutzen Sie natürlichsprachige Abfragen, um komplexe Codebasen zu durchdringen, Probleme zu identifizieren und situationsbezogene Unterstützung zu erhalten, ohne die Entwicklungsumgebung zu wechseln.
• Teamkooperation: Ermöglicht KI-gestützte Diskussionen und gemeinsame Arbeitsabläufe zur Verbesserung von Kommunikation und Effizienz in Entwicklungsteams.
• Mehrsprachen-Unterstützung: Unterstützt Codeerstellung und -bearbeitung in sämtlichen Programmiersprachen durch Dateityperkennung – geeignet für diverse Projektanforderungen.
• Unternehmensweite Entwicklung: Verarbeitet umfangreiche Codebasen und integriert Unternehmenssicherheitsrichtlinien, ideal für Fortune-1000-Unternehmen.